Joda Alana  (Joda Aly Dahr x Joda Dsert Gazella)
The beautiful Joda Alana! Sired by Australian Champion Joda Aly Dahr. Alana is the dam of twice New Zealand Reserve National Champion Mare, WA State Champion Colt, State Champion Victorian Amateur Colt, QLD Challenge Show Reserve Champion Intermediate filly, and Champion Junior Filly at the Pan Pacific show Chaswyck Resheikah.
Alana is also the dam of our very own Eirinn's Spirit, sired by Baarafic imp US (dec) and an exceptional filly by Marja Ra’sha, Eirinn’s Bint Al Kamar (Meaning Ireland’s Daughter of the Moon).
Joda Alana is grandam to numerous A class champions including the current WA Champion 3&4 yr old colt,  Kairo Bey Legend.

Chaswyck Angelikova (Baarafic imp USA (dec) x Chaswyck Annakova)
Chaswyck Angelikova is a true testament to Arabian type and her pedigree is flawless beyond words. Her dam Chaswyck Annakova is one of the most breathtaking mares you would ever have the pleasure of laying eyes on and, as stated by her breeder, Lorraine Bond: “We think she is actually better than Annie” (Chaswyck Annakova).  Annakova (Chaswyck Ace of Spades x Simeon Shakova), sold to UAE, was Pan Pacific Champion Filly and is the granddaughter of the legendary and ethereal Prince Fa Moniet, who has been a progentator of countless International, National and World Champions including the granddaughter Johara Al Naif who was world champion filly in Paris at the Salon Du Cheval.
Annakova’s Grand dam is Australian Champion Mare, Simeon Sukari, sired by Asfour out of 27-Ibn Galal-5.
Chaswyck Annakova’s sire is Chaswyck Ace of Spades (dec) who was sired by Simeon Sochain, Australian Champion Stallion and Australian Horse of the Year Reserve Champion Under Saddle. At the age of 16 Sochain was sold to the U.S. Sochain’s own sire is two times reserve world champion stallion, Simeon Sadik, who sold for $1 Million and is currently owned by the wife of Rolling Stone’s drummer.

Chaswyck Nile Queen (Chaswyck Ace of Spades (dec) x Talalle Marousha exp NZ)
Chaswyck Nile Queen is a breathtakingly beautiful work of Egyptian Arabian Art. Her incredible beauty and fluent movement are a result of a pedigree based on some leading Australian blood lines. Chaswyck Nile Queen’s sire is the short lived but incredible progenitor, Chaswyck Ace of Spades (Simeon Sochain exp US x Simeon Sooka (dec). Simeon Sochain was an Australian Show Champion and Simeon Sooka is half sister to Breeders’ World Cup Reserve champion mare, Simeon Sehavi.

Seraphina of Chaswyck (Baarafic x Chaswyck On Gossemer Wings)
Seraphina of Chaswyck, is out of Chaswyck on Gossemer Wings, who as a yearling was crowned Pan Pacific Supreme Champion. Chaswyck on Gossamer Wings is a powerhouse, when it comes to movement and was Lorraine Bond’s favourite mare. She is by one of the world’s most influential stallions, Asfour, who has produced countless State, National and International champions as well as Reserve World champions. Asfour has progeny and grand get in every continent in the world except for Antarctica. He is out of Dr Hanz Nagel’s most prominent mare, Hanan, a mare that features prominently in equine literature. Chaswyck on Gossemer Wings’ dam is the incredible progenitor, Simeon Sooka, whose own dam is Simeon Sheba, making Sooka a half sister to Las Vegas Breeders’ World Cup Reserve Champion Mare and European Egyptian Event Supreme Champion, Simeon Sehavi, who sold for $2.2 million and now resides in Dubai.

Chaswyck Ivory Satin (Baarafic imp US x Chaswck Diamonds Are Forever exp UAE)

Chaswyck Ivory Satin is sired by Baarafic who was twice awarded Supreme Champion at the Pan Pacific under two highly internationally acclaimed judges, Elisabeth Salmon and Dr Nasr Marei as a yearling and as a two year old. Baarafic was the son of Reserve World Champion, Imperial Baarez, who has successfully competed in dressage. Baarafic’s dam, Azaamah, was a winner in both performance (English Pleasure) and in halter. She was sired by the Super Sire, Tammen, (owned by Patrick Swayze) and was out of Aleeyah, who was half sister to Amin, a noted performance, halter and working cow horse, who was awarded the Legion of Supreme Honour and was ranked seventh in the Arabian Horse World’s Top Reining Horses (1995-2004), receiving 9 National Top Tens and 1 Reserve National Championship as a Working Cow Horse.

Chaswyck Ophelia (Simeon Sochain exp US x GR Madarah imp Ger/exp UAE
Chaswyck Ophelia is the foundation mare of Glen Eirinn Arabian Stud; she has produced two lovely colts, with her strong hindquarters and huge dark eyes and her sire’s signature movement.
Ophelia”s dam, GR Madarah, bred in Germany by the prestigious Rothenburg Stud, was sired by the most decorated son of Classic Shadwan (Alidaar x Shagia Bint Shadwan), GR Amaretto, who has offspring in 15 countries and 5 continents. Besides being awarded Gold at the German Stallion Show, some of GR Amaretto’s titles include German National Champion and European Egyptian Event Senior Champion. Madarah is the granddaughter of the Kaisoon and Bint Magdi, two prolific producers and this ability to produce exceptional stock is certainly reflected in their descendents. Chaswyck Amber Sylk (Simeon Sochain exp U.S x Chaswyck Annakova exp UAE)

Chaswyck Amber Sylk is sired by Australian Reserve Champion saddle horse of the Year and Australian Reserve National Champion colt and Supreme male at the Queensland State Championships, Simeon Sochain. Simeon Sochain has produced champions in Endurance, halter and Performance including Dunbar Mahadik who was runner up in the 2008 Tom Quilty and Chaswyck Toi Boy who has many wins in halter including Champion colt at the Pan Pacific and Reserve Championships under saddle. Chaswyck Toi Boy has also recently started his endurance career and sired, Anniversary Wish who won the 80km endurance ride and best conditioned at the Australian Championships. Simeon Sochain’s sire is the most decorated black Straight Egyptian stallion in history, Simeon Sadik, who was twice awarded Reserve World Champion. Simeon Sochain is out of Simeon Simona, one of Simeon Stud’s most prized broodmares, who is also dam to Simeon Sochain’s ¾ brother Simeon Sadran exp US (now residing in Dubai), who was 2004 East Coast Champion colt.
Chaswyck Amber Sylk is out of one of Chaswyck Stud’s most beautiful mares, Chaswyck Annakova. Chaswyck Annakova was awarded Champion Intermediate Filly at the 2006 Pan Pacific under the highly acclaimed judge, Elisabeth Salmon and she was also awarded State Champion filly at the Queensland Challenge Show.

Chaswyck Bint Shakhaf (Chaswyck Ace of Spades x Simeon Shakhaf)
Chaswyck Bint Shakhaf is the newest addition to Glen Eirinn Arabians’ mare band and has one of the most influential pedigrees to be found anywhere in the world. Her dam, Simeon Shakhaf, was the full sister to two times Reserve World Champion, Simeon Sadik. Simeon Shakhaf only produced two foals before her untimely death. Her first foal, Chaswyck Caliph (dec), the ¾ brother to Chaswyck Bint Shakhaf, was the foundation stallion of Glen Eirinn Arabians.  He had been crowned Pan Pacific Champion Colt under Dr Nasr Marei. Chaswyck Bint Shakhaf was sired by Chaswyck Ace of Spades, who also sired Pan Pacific Champion Filly, Chaswyck Annakova (exp UAE). Chaswyck Ace of Spade’s dam is the maternal half sister to the Unanimous Australian Champion Mare, European Supreme Champion Straight Egyptian Mare and Las Vegas Breeders’ World Cup Reserve Champion, Simeon Sehavi (exp UAE).
